What counts as a “Source”?

Data from IBISWorld counts as one source because they generate and gather the data themselves (unless otherwise noted in the report).  

The other two databases are tools that bring together information from many different sources. Each document you find in Business Source Complete, or dataset in Statista, counts as one unique source.

To find the source information in Business Source Complete, click on the title of a document and look for the Cite icon on the left side of the screen.

To find the source information in Statista, click on the title of a dataset and find the source listed in a box on the left side of the page.

APA Citation Help

APA is an acronym for the American Psychological Association.  The Publication Manual  of the American Psychological Association is often used for research work in the social sciences.

MLA Style Help

MLA stands for Modern Languages Association.  The MLA Style Manual is often used for formatting and citing  references when writing papers in the liberal arts and humanities.
